About Allison Cook

Much of my career has focused on donor stewardship. I have crafted tailored newsletters, hosted breakfast focus groups, sent surveys, forwarded articles of interest, and had bags of dog treats at the ready for my donors’ puppies. Through these efforts, I sought to truly know my donors, understand their passions and goals, and create a bond between them and my organization. This stewardship mindset is equally important to utilize with those whom my organization and donors serve. It is important to help others on their own terms; not on terms dictated by myself or others not directly impacted by the issue we aim to address. By building relationships based on trust and openness, those who are most impacted by an issue can feel safe sharing with me and my organization how we can help them to overcome the challenges they face. I believe in this principle with my entire being and continue to bring this belief to my job each day. It is for this reason that I was so excited to join the staff of the Trust For Public Land. Since its founding in 1972, Trust For Public Land has been a conservation organization fueled by innovation and its commitment to social justice. Building coalitions; committing to involving community residents from the very beginning of any project; and exploring novel ways to meet every person’s need for safe, accessible, outdoor space has been a part of Trust For Public Land’s ethos from the very beginning. They take on the projects others pass over: brownfield remediation; protection of important (often lesser known) Civil Rights sites to preserve history for future generations; complex flooding and stormwater management locations; ensuring affordable housing remains in communities where new parks are built; greenspaces that cross multiple governmental jurisdictions and require a high level of finesse and negotiation. I am proud to be a part of the team making this type of brave and informed conservation possible.
